Output f966914de634b3affe3edcfc3d43128aff4ab895b2cfdaf94cc5cec1deee4c6c:0

value
180189017
script pubkey
OP_0 OP_PUSHBYTES_20 003209686c05950a65eecefe77f6fdbf184a14de
address
bc1qqqeqj6rvqk2s5e0weml80ahahuvy59x7hltemu
transaction
f966914de634b3affe3edcfc3d43128aff4ab895b2cfdaf94cc5cec1deee4c6c
confirmations
297003
spent
true